Residents and residential or commercial property managers across the Hills District frequently turn to regional electricians for a wide variety of services beyond basic repair work. Switchboard upgrades are amongst the most requested jobs, particularly in homes constructed before the 1990s that may still be operating on older fuse systems rather than modern-day circuit breakers with safety switches. Information and interactions cabling has also risen in demand as more families work from home and require fast, reliable web connections throughout their residential or commercial properties. Security is always the vital concern when it comes to electrical work, and this is a worth shared by every reliable electrician in the Hills District. Unlicensed electrical work is not just unsafe but also prohibited in NSW, and the repercussions of do it yourself electrical repairs can vary from insurance voidance to devastating house fires. Homeowners are urged to constantly confirm that their picked electrician in the Hills District holds a present electrical contractor licence issued by NSW Fair Trading which the specific tradespeople on site are effectively licenced too. Looking for public liability insurance and examining consumer reviews from within the regional neighborhood is also sound practice.
